Nonetheless, some people might not wish to make an application for Medicare Part B (Medical Insurance) when they come to be eligible. You can delay registration in Medicare read review Part B scot-free if you fit one of the complying with categories. If you transform 65, proceed to function, and also are covered by a company team health insurance, you may intend to postpone registering in Medicare Component B.


If you turn 65 as well as are covered under your functioning partner's company group health and wellness strategy, you might want to delay enrolling in Medicare Component B. Keep in mind: Team health insurance of companies with 20 or description even more staff members must supply partners of energetic employees the very same wellness benefits no matter age or health status.

You will not be enlisting late, so you will certainly not have any kind of penalty. If you pick protection under the employer group health insurance plan and also are still working, Medicare will be the "additional payer," which indicates the employer plan pays initially. If the employer group health insurance does not pay all the client's expenditures, Medicare might pay the whole equilibrium, a section, or absolutely nothing.

Medicare is a UNITED STATE government medical insurance program. The strategy covers individuals age 65 or older, younger ones with disabilities, as well as individuals with end-stage kidney disease. Medicare is comprised of a number of strategies covering particular aspects of healthcare, and also some come with a cost for the insured. While this enables the program to use participants much more choices in terms of prices and insurance coverage, it additionally presents complexity for those seeking to register.


Any person with ALS instantly gets approved for Medicare, no matter of age. Premiums for Medicare Part A, which covers healthcare facility keeps as well as other inpatient care, are cost-free if the guaranteed individual or their partner added to Medicare for 10 or even more years with their payroll tax obligations. You are in charge of paying costs for various other components of the Medicare program.
